Celanese Corporation is a global chemical leader in the production of differentiated chemistry solutions and specialty materials used in most major industries and consumer applications. Our businesses use the full breadth of Celanese's global chemistry, technology and commercial expertise to create value for our customers, employees, shareholders and the corporation. As we partner with our customers to solve their most critical business needs, we strive to make a positive impact on our communities and the world through The Celanese Foundation. Based in Dallas, Celanese employs approximately 13,000 employees worldwide and had 2023 net sales of $10.9 billion. The Quality Control Technician supports manufacturing processes by performing routine in-process testing; finished product testing in accordance with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), protocols and product specifications; and by making decisions regarding product quality and inventory release.
Position requires teamwork and cooperation with other plant partners such as maintenance, operations and technical departments. This position is staffed on a 24 hour/ 7-day basis via 12 hour rotating shifts. Position requires effective and timely communication with other plant personnel such as operations and technical group. 5R operations are additionally supported - training of 5R QC/extruder operators and calibration + troubleshooting of 5R lab equipment are performed by QC Technician.
